Government of Canada announces recipients of $100-million Feminist Response and Recovery Fund

Share this article Share this article OTTAWA, ON, July 29, 2021 /CNW/ - Advancing gender equality is a key priority for the Government of Canada. The COVID-19 pandemic has magnified systemic and longstanding inequalities, with women and girls disproportionately impacted by the crisis. Women have faced job losses and reduced work hours, shouldered the majority of the additional unpaid care responsibilities at home, and continue to be on the front lines of the pandemic. As Canada moves towards an inclusive recovery, meaningful progress to advance gender equality is needed now more than ever to ensure no one is left behind. To further support critical recovery efforts led by the women s and equality-seeking movement, today the Honourable Maryam Monsef, Minister for Women and Gender Equality and Rural Economic Development, announced 237 projects to receive funding under the $100 million Feminist Response and Recovery Fund call for proposals.

New report indicates potential investing gap for BC s early-stage startups

New report indicates potential investing gap for BC’s early-stage startups A new analysis by Hockeystick of British Columbia’s deal activity for 2020 shows a gap in early-stage startup funding. Hockeystick’s BC Tech Report looks at how the province’s tech ecosystem fared in terms of deals and dollars, with data sourced through exclusive partnerships with organizations like the Canadian Venture Capital and Private Equity Association (CVCA). Hockeystick also compiles data from startups using its platform, as well as public data sources. In 2020, BC saw general capital support across all stages. Early-stage deals accounted for 31 percent of all deals, while Series A deals accounted for 20 percent, and late-stage deals accounted for 40 percent. Since Hockeystick’s Q2 2020 report, there has been consistent late-stage activity for the region.
